PSY 535 - Psychology Of Death And Dying

Effectivity: 08/27/2001 - 05/10/2003 @ Purdue Calumet Traditional
Credits: 3
Instructional Types: Lec
Usually Offered: spr
Short Title: Psych Of Death & Dying
Description: An examination of psychological research and theory related to death and the dying process. Topics include:(1) death concepts, attitudes and fears-historical and contemporary, 2) definitions and predictors of death (physical, psycho-social predictors of death), effects of death on survivors, psycho-social factors related to individual differences and normative dying behavior, stages of dying, effects of pain and drugs, managing the dying process.
